Clover Health is a healthcare technology company helping members live their healthiest lives with our Medicare Advantage plans. Focused on seniors who have historically lacked access to affordable and high-quality healthcare, Clover aims to provide care sustainably by improving medical outcomes while simultaneously lowering avoidable costs. They leverage a proprietary software platform, the Clover Assistant, to aggregate patient data and offer real-time recommendations to healthcare providers. Their services include affordable Medicare Advantage plans, a home care program, and they manage care for Medicare Advantage members across several U. S. states.

• Review Home Health prior authorization requests using CMS regulations, Medicare Benefit Policy, NCD/LCD criteria, and Clover guidelines • Complete initial and concurrent medical necessity reviews for Home Health services • Maintain an active review workload while meeting quality, productivity, and turnaround expectations • Apply clinical judgment and escalate complex cases to Medical Directors • Collaborate with providers, home health agencies, case managers, and internal teams to obtain clinical documentation • Document determinations in utilization management systems and electronic medical records • Identify opportunities to optimize care and appropriate Home Health utilization • Provide day-to-day clinical leadership and support to the Home Health UM nursing team • Serve as the primary resource for complex cases, CMS policy interpretation, and clinical guidance • Conduct quality audits and reviewer calibration • Perform monthly quality reviews and maintain greater than 90% reviewer concordance • Monitor productivity, quality, turnaround times, and workload distribution • Identify utilization trends, perform root cause analyses, and implement process improvements • Mentor and coach reviewing nurses • Train reviewers on episodic and per-visit Home Health authorization methodologies • Support onboarding, competency validation, and ongoing staff education • Partner with Home Health agencies to review utilization trends and strengthen collaboration • Work with Contracting to evaluate agency performance and support a high-quality provider network • Collaborate with cross-functional partners to improve workflows, consistency, and member outcomes • Support implementation of new CMS guidance, internal policies, and UM initiatives • Serve as the clinical escalation point before Medical Director review • Foster a collaborative, accountable, and high-performing team culture
• Current Compact Registered Nurse (RN) license (required) • 5+ years of clinical nursing experience in Home Health, Utilization Management, Case Management, or Medicare Advantage (required) • 2+ years of Home Health medical necessity review experience using CMS criteria (required) • Experience leading, mentoring, coaching, or developing clinical staff (preferred) • Expertise in CMS regulations, the Medicare Benefit Policy Manual, and NCD/LCD criteria • Experience with quality reviews, performance calibration, or clinical education (preferred) • Organized and analytical, with ability to balance leadership and direct clinical review responsibilities • Proficiency with electronic medical records and utilization management systems • Ability to work collaboratively in a fast-paced environment focused on member outcomes
